The rosters for the third annual HBCU Swingman Classic are set.
This showcase, scheduled for Friday, July 11, at Truist Park in Atlanta, is a highlight of MLB All-Star Week and celebrates standout baseball players from Historically Black Colleges and Universities across the nation.
Fifty student-athletes were chosen by a selection committee that included Hall of Famer and event namesake Ken Griffey Jr., representatives from MLB, the MLBPA, and members of the baseball scouting community.
Former Atlanta Braves stars Brian Jordan and David Justice will serve as team managers, with Jordan guiding the National League squad and Justice leading the American League team.
The event will also welcome a distinguished group of honorary VIPs, including Hall of Famer and HBCU alumnus Andre Dawson, former MLB manager Dusty Baker, three-time All-Star and two-time World Series champion Ken Griffey Sr., and All-Star and HBCU alumnus Ralph Garr Sr.
Both teams’ coaching staffs are composed of former professional players and HBCU alumni, offering participants valuable mentorship opportunities.

The 50 selected players represent a wide array of HBCUs, such as Alabama A&M, Alcorn State, Bethune-Cookman, Coppin State, Florida A&M, Grambling State, Jackson State, Mississippi Valley State, Morehouse, Norfolk State, North Carolina A&T, Prairie View A&M, Southern, Texas Southern, Arkansas-Pine Bluff, and Maryland Eastern Shore.
Several athletes in this year’s Classic have previously participated in elite MLB development programs, including the Hank Aaron Invitational and the Breakthrough Series. Irvin Escobar will make his third appearance in the Swingman Classic, while seven others are returning.
The event will also feature pregame festivities celebrating HBCU culture, including performances by marching bands, a Divine Nine Step show, and more.
